Transaction 10a1fbda7c61c0c96282319f578805886b645bbefc5d1d25f56cb8ebad856ef8
1 Input
1 Output
-
10a1fbda7c61c0c96282319f578805886b645bbefc5d1d25f56cb8ebad856ef8:0
- value
- 19892032
- script pubkey
- OP_0 OP_PUSHBYTES_20 b90fee199d407c8644fa1b28d9790d5384f27754
- address
- bc1qhy87uxvagp7gv386rv5dj7gd2wz0ya65gxu8la